Partition maintenance for the Orvalle ledger tables runs monthly. Before the first of each month, confirm the next partition exists in the warehouse schema; the helper script creates it but will not backfill. If you run the script manually from your workstation, it reads credentials from your local env file. Add the warehouse token to that file before invoking it.

secret setting of hawep-yahig: LEDGER_TOKEN29=41b5d6315371c92885eaeb077fb63

Title: Scheduler double-waters bed 3 after DST shift

New folks: the Verdella scheduler stores watering slots in local time. After the clock change, slot 06:00 fires twice, soaking the herb bed. Fix: store UTC, convert at display. Repro on the Oakhollow test rig only. To reproduce, install the firmware identified by the token below.

build token for hafop-kahog: htk31_a432ac515d5bb1362002c1e1a7e80ef

## Font vendoring limits

All typefaces bundled into Quennick must be vendored under `assets/fonts/` with license files retained. To keep bundle size and build times predictable, we enforce hard caps on family count, per-file size, and total payload. Exceeding any cap fails CI deliberately. The enforced quotas are defined here.

tuning constants:
QUOTAS = {
    "druwyn": 5,
    "holix": 5,
    "zorath": 5,
    "holwyn": 10,
}